From d28195c08ca67cf6190d78251dcb0515a9cbfa21 Mon Sep 17 00:00:00 2001 From: Claude Date: Thu, 2 Jul 2026 15:34:44 +0000 Subject: [PATCH] fix(security): harden the exec/FS trust boundary in server_actions MIME-Version: 1.0 Content-Type: text/plain; charset=UTF-8 Content-Transfer-Encoding: 8bit Three injection classes were reachable from GUI-supplied values: 1. Remote command injection. The SSH paths in executeAction/streamLogs/ getServerStatus built 'ssh podman ... ' with no protection; ssh concatenates its remote args into one string the remote login shell re-parses, so a container_name like 'foo; rm -rf /' ran the rm. (executeSSH existed but was unused AND its own '--' does not stop remote-shell reparsing — its doc comment was wrong.) 2. SSH option injection. An unvalidated host such as '-oProxyCommand=evil' is read by ssh as an option. 3. Path traversal. run_script accepted 'scripts/../../etc/x' (prefix check only); write_server_config interpolated a raw profile_id into a path; and Settings.xml element text was interpolated with no escaping (operator attrs escaped only '"'). Fixes: - Allowlist validators isSafeContainerName / isSafeHost / isSafeProfileId reject every shell metacharacter and path-traversal char at the boundary. - Single SSH path: the three callers build a bare command and route through dispatch() -> executeSSH, which now POSIX-single-quotes every remote arg (shellQuoteInto) as defence-in-depth; false doc comment corrected. - run_script also rejects '..' components and absolute paths. - write_server_config validates profile_id and XML-escapes all five entities in every interpolated value (xmlEscapeInto/Alloc). - parseAndDispatch converts validation errors into a structured failure result instead of propagating. - 10 adversarial unit tests (injection payloads, traversal, quoting, escaping). Grep-gate: no inline 'ssh' arg-building remains. 150 tests green. Also adds timeout-minutes to push-email-notify.yml (Hypatia workflow_audit).
